Ndnizing existing applications: Research issues and experiences

T Liang, J Pan, B Zhang - Proceedings of the 5th ACM Conference on …, 2018 - dl.acm.org
A major challenge to potential ICN/NDN deployment is the requirement of application
support, namely, applications need to be rewritten or modified in order to run on NDN …

Making crdts byzantine fault tolerant

M Kleppmann - Proceedings of the 9th Workshop on Principles and …, 2022 - dl.acm.org
It is often claimed that Conflict-free Replicated Data Types (CRDTs) ensure consistency of
replicated data in peer-to-peer systems. However, peer-to-peer systems usually consist of …

OrderlessChain: A CRDT-based BFT Coordination-free Blockchain Without Global Order of Transactions

P Nasirifard, R Mayer, HA Jacobsen - Proceedings of the 24th …, 2023 - dl.acm.org
Existing permissioned blockchains often rely on coordination-based consensus protocols to
ensure the safe execution of applications in a Byzantine environment. Furthermore, the …

Practical client-side replication: Weak consistency semantics for insecure settings

A van der Linde, J Leitão, N Preguiça - Proceedings of the VLDB …, 2020 - dl.acm.org
Client-side replication and direct client-to-client synchronization can be used to create highly
available, low-latency interactive applications. Causal consistency, the strongest available …

Beaufort: Robust byzantine fault tolerance for client-centric mobile web applications

K Jannes, EH Beni, B Lagaisse… - IEEE Transactions on …, 2023 - ieeexplore.ieee.org
In recent years, part of the web is shifting to a client-centric, decentralized model where web
clients become the leading execution environment for application logic and data storage …

Online brand community and consumer brand trust: Analysis from Czech millennials

J Amoah, AB Jibril, S Bankuoru Egala… - Cogent Business & …, 2022 - Taylor & Francis
To ensure effective and efficient relationship marketing, brand management has become an
asset (pre-requisite) for quality service marketing to thrive. Brands have gone viral to …

PushPin: Towards production-quality peer-to-peer collaboration

P van Hardenberg, M Kleppmann - Proceedings of the 7th Workshop on …, 2020 - dl.acm.org
Fully peer-to-peer application software promises many benefits over cloud software, in
particular, being able to function indefinitely without requiring servers. Research on …

Byzantine eventual consistency and the fundamental limits of peer-to-peer databases

M Kleppmann, H Howard - arXiv preprint arXiv:2012.00472, 2020 - arxiv.org
Sybil attacks, in which a large number of adversary-controlled nodes join a network, are a
concern for many peer-to-peer database systems, necessitating expensive …

OWebSync: Seamless synchronization of distributed web clients

K Jannes, B Lagaisse, W Joosen - IEEE Transactions on …, 2021 - ieeexplore.ieee.org
Many enterprise software services are adopting a fully web-based architecture for both
internal line-of-business applications and for online customer-facing applications. Although …

Personal volunteer computing

E Lavoie, L Hendren - Proceedings of the 16th ACM International …, 2019 - dl.acm.org
We propose personal volunteer computing, a novel paradigm to encourage technical
solutions that leverage personal devices, such as smartphones and laptops, for personal …